Rocci Joins the Pirates

The South West Metro Pirates are very excited to welcome Maddison Rocci to our MMG NBL1 Women's team for the 2023 season.

Maddy played her whole junior career at Werribee in Victoria. In 2014 she gained a spot in the U17 Sapphires for the World Cup and then 2 years later the U19 Gems Australian World Cup team. In 2020 she was selected as part of the Australian Opals squad.

Maddy began her WNBL career in 2017 when she signed with the Canberra Capitals. Her time with the Caps being very successful winning back to back WNBL titles. She is currently playing for the Southside Flyers in the WNBL where she is averaging 13 points 6 assists and 7 rebounds a game. Last year in the NBL1 North competition she averaged 26 points 5 assists and 3 rebounds.

Maddy with her tenacious defence and strong drive to the basket will give us some major strength in the back court. She will join the team at the conclusion of the WNBL season in March.
